SPC ROBERT FRIESE MEM. HWY H.B. 5394:
SUMMARY OF HOUSE-PASSED BILL
IN COMMITTEE
House Bill 5394 (as passed by the House)
Sponsor: Representative Jason Wentworth
House Committee: Transportation and Infrastructure
Senate Committee: Transportation
CONTENT
The bill would amend the Michigan Memorial Highway Act to designate Business Route 127 in Clare County as the "SPC Robert Friese Memorial Highway".
The bill would take effect 90 days after it was enacted.
BACKGROUND
Army SPC Robert Friese died on April 29, 2011, in Iraq after being attacked by enemy forces. He was born in Clare, Michigan, and graduated from Harrison High School in 2007. SPC Friese enlisted in the Army in 2010 as a Tanker and was stationed at Fort Hood, Texas, with the 3rd Armored Cavalry Regiment until he was deployed to Iraq in January 2011. SPC Friese was awarded the Purple Heart and promoted to Specialist posthumously.

FISCAL IMPACT
The bill would have no fiscal impact on State or local government.
